Anne-Marie Riedinger, CCA, former President of the IAA (2009-2011), graduated in Medical Art from the Haute Ecole des Arts du Rhin (former ESADS) in Strasbourg, France, where she eventually became a teacher (1996-2000). She specialized in facial prosthetics at the University of Illinois, Chicago, USA. A pioneer in France for facial bone anchored prostheses since 1986, she is the owner of the Centre d’Epitheses Faciales in Strasbourg and Paris, France. She is an international consultant for bone anchored surgery, and has given lectures, workshops and has written a number of articles in the field, for national and international journals. Her areas of interest are bone anchored prostheses, research, teaching and transmitting skills and knowledge.
